Belfast men escape from County Donegal court

Two Belfast men have escaped from Garda custody in County Donegal during a court appearance.

The men were brought before Letterkenny Court on charges of theft yesterday morning and managed to escape from the court during a brief adjournment.

John Quinn, 48, from Cavanmore Gardens and 34-year-old Joseph McQuade from Ross Street, were arrested on Monday over the theft of cash from the Bridgend Hotel in 2005.

It is understood that when arrested, the pair had both pleaded guilty to the charges.

After the brief court adjournment, the defendants indicated to gardai that they were intending to return to the courtroom, however they then ran out through the front door.

It has been reported that a pregnant woman held the automatic doors open for the men allowing them to escape.

The judge criticised gardai for their lax in security and said that he could not issue a warrant for the men's arrest as the men were not on bail.
